Quattro Formaggi Pizza Recipe (Four Cheese Pizza)

Description

Quattro Formaggi Pizza is a classic Italian four-cheese pizza featuring a crispy thin crust topped with mozzarella, gorgonzola, fontina, and parmesan. It is rich, creamy, and flavorful with no tomato sauce, allowing the cheese blend to shine.


Ingredients

  • 160 g all-purpose flour
  • 100 ml warm water
  • 1 g active dry yeast
  • 1 tsp olive oil
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• A pinch of sugar
  • 1 pizza dough (prepared)
  • 1/3 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
  • 1/4 cup crumbled gorgonzola or blue cheese
  • 1/4 cup shredded fontina or taleggio cheese
  • 2 tbsp grated parmesan cheese
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• Fresh basil or parsley (optional)

Instructions

  1. Mix warm water, sugar, and yeast; let sit until foamy.
  2. Combine flour and salt, then add yeast mixture and olive oil to form dough.
  3. Knead until smooth, then let rise until doubled in size.
  4. Preheat oven to 475°F (245°C) with a pizza stone or tray inside.
  5. Roll dough into a thin 10–12 inch circle.
  6. Transfer to parchment or pizza peel.
  7. Top with mozzarella, gorgonzola, fontina, and parmesan.
  8. Drizzle with olive oil.
  9. Bake for 8–12 minutes until crust is crispy and cheese is melted.
  10. Garnish with herbs, slice, and serve.

Notes

  • Use a very hot oven for best crisp crust.
  • Do not overload with cheese to avoid sogginess.
  • Blue cheese can replace gorgonzola if needed.
  • Preheating the baking surface improves texture.
  • Best served immediately while cheese is hot and gooey.
